Robert Cregan (born 4 November 1988 inDublin,Ireland) is anIrish racing driver. He competed in the2012 GP3 Series season forOcean Racing Technology. He finished second in the 2010-11 UAE GT Championship - GTC.[1] He is the son ofRichard Cregan, who was the team manager of theToyota Formula One team.[2]
Cregan's racing career began in 2002.[2] He raced in the 2006 Formula Ford 1600 Walter Hayes Trophy, finishing twelfth.[3]
He moved into sportscars in 2008, competing in two races in the2008 Porsche Supercup season. Cregan finished second in the 2010-11 UAE GT Championship - GTC, winning three of the six races he competed in.[3]
He joined theFujitsu V8 Supercar Series in 2011, in the process becoming the first Irishman to compete in the series.[2] He competed for Matt Stone Racing in aFord Falcon (BF) and scored 747 points from the 17 races.[3]
Cregan returned to single-seater racing in 2012 when he competed forOcean Racing Technology in the2012 GP3 Series season.[3] He failed to score a point and finished in 22nd in the Drivers' Championship standings.
